My name is Aarushi and I am a MEng Aerospace Electronic Engineering student at University of Southampton with over 5 years of tutoring experience in Maths, Further Maths and Physics. I love making tricky topics click for others and bring energy, curiosity, and the occasional space fact to every lesson! I graduated with a First Class Honours in my undergraduate studies in Aerospace Electronic Engineering, during which I was honoured with accolades including the National AI and Robotics Student of the Year award and the prestigious Arkwright Engineering Scholarship. Academically, I achieved top grades across all my GCSE and A-Level subjects, earning A*s in Mathematics, Further Mathematics, and Physics. Having worked within an educational environment for more than 15 years, I have taught English and Humanities subjects remotely for over 5 years. Throughout all of this time it has been privilege to help students progress, and obtain improved grades. I have supported ESL students with exam preparation, and current class subjects such as; Humanities, Science, and English. Additionally, I have supported students applying to university, by helping with personal statements and UCAS applications. In the classroom, my goal has always been to inspire students so that they can gain confidence in their subjects. My classes are always fun and engaging. Students learn at different paces and in different ways so often need time to understand what they are learning. Therefore, I patiently use a variety of teaching materials to consolidate concepts, ideas and dates. These are then reinforced through in-class practice. Mini class quizzes identify areas for additional support, and exam preparation help students feel comfortable and better prepared when it comes to taking their all important exams and tests.
